4. Ant attraction
The presence of ants on peony buds is a widely recognized, though not universally reliable, indicator pertaining to the timing of peony bloom harvest. While often cited as a signal of readiness, a nuanced understanding of this phenomenon is necessary to prevent misinterpretation and ensure optimal bloom quality.
-
Nectar Secretion as an Attractant
Peony buds secrete a sugary nectar, particularly at the bud scales, that attracts ants. This nectar production typically increases as the bud matures and prepares to open. The ants are drawn to this food source and, in their search for nectar, serve as an easily observable sign of bud development. However, the level of nectar secretion can vary depending on factors such as weather conditions and peony variety. Therefore, the absence of ants does not necessarily indicate immaturity, and their presence alone is insufficient to determine harvest readiness.
-
Alternative Food Sources and Ant Behavior
Ants are opportunistic foragers and may be present on peony buds not solely for nectar, but also in search of other insects or honeydew secreted by aphids. Furthermore, their activity levels fluctuate throughout the day and are influenced by environmental factors such as temperature and rainfall. Relying solely on ant presence can be misleading if alternative food sources are abundant or if weather conditions are unfavorable for ant activity. A thorough assessment of bud development, considering other indicators, is necessary to avoid premature or delayed harvesting.
-
Potential Benefits and Detrimental Effects
The presence of ants may offer a minor benefit to peony buds by deterring other, more damaging insects. However, their activity is primarily superficial and does not contribute significantly to bloom quality or plant health. Conversely, heavy ant infestations can sometimes lead to the introduction of sooty mold or other fungal diseases, particularly if the ants are tending to aphids. Therefore, while ant attraction can serve as one potential clue, it should not be the sole basis for determining the ideal time to cut peony blooms.

6. Weather conditions
Weather conditions exert a significant influence on the optimal timing for harvesting peony blooms. Temperature, precipitation, humidity, and wind all play a role in bud development, stem strength, and overall flower quality, thereby affecting the determination of when peonies are best suited for cutting.
-
Temperature Fluctuations and Bloom Development
Temperature variations directly impact the rate of peony bud development. Periods of prolonged heat can accelerate blooming, leading to a shorter harvest window and potentially reduced vase life. Conversely, extended cool spells can delay bud formation and flowering. Extreme temperature fluctuations can also cause bud blast, where the buds fail to open properly. Accurate monitoring of temperature patterns is essential for predicting bloom times and adjusting harvesting schedules accordingly. For example, growers in regions with unpredictable spring weather often use shade cloths or other protective measures to mitigate the effects of extreme temperatures on bud development.
-
Precipitation and Disease Risk
Rainfall and humidity levels influence the susceptibility of peony buds to fungal diseases, such as botrytis blight. Prolonged wet conditions create an environment conducive to fungal growth, potentially damaging the buds and reducing their marketability. Cutting peonies during or immediately after rainfall increases the risk of spreading fungal spores, further exacerbating the problem. It is advisable to delay harvesting until the foliage and buds have dried thoroughly. Some growers apply preventative fungicides to protect their crops from disease, but careful timing of irrigation and harvesting can also minimize the risk.
-
Wind and Physical Damage
Strong winds can cause physical damage to peony stems and buds, leading to bruising, breakage, and reduced aesthetic appeal. Wind can also accelerate water loss from the buds, causing them to dry out prematurely. Selecting a harvest time that avoids periods of high wind can minimize these risks. Planting peonies in sheltered locations or using windbreaks can also help to protect them from wind damage. In areas prone to severe storms, some growers use netting or other protective structures to shield their crops.
-
Sunlight Intensity and Color Development
Sunlight intensity affects the color development of peony blooms. Adequate sunlight is necessary for the formation of vibrant, saturated colors. However, excessive sunlight can lead to sunscald, where the buds become bleached or scorched. The optimal balance of sunlight and shade varies depending on the peony variety and the specific environmental conditions. In regions with intense sunlight, some growers use shade cloths to protect their crops from sunscald and maintain the desired color intensity. 7. Time of day
The specific time of day when peony blooms are harvested directly influences their hydration levels, sugar content, and overall post-harvest performance. Careful consideration of diurnal physiological cycles within the plant is paramount for optimizing vase life and aesthetic quality. Timing cutting appropriately can dramatically affect the freshness and longevity of the cut flowers.
-
Morning Harvest Advantages
Early morning, prior to the onset of significant heat, represents the optimal time for peony harvesting. During this period, plants are typically fully turgid, having replenished their water reserves overnight. Stems are firm and well-hydrated, maximizing their ability to transport water to the bloom after cutting. Sugar concentrations within the stem are also generally higher in the morning, providing an energy source for the flower’s continued development. Harvesting during the cooler morning hours minimizes water loss due to transpiration, resulting in a more robust and longer-lasting cut flower.
-
Midday Harvest Disadvantages
Harvesting peonies during the heat of midday is generally discouraged. Throughout the day, plants experience increased transpiration rates, leading to a reduction in water turgor and potential wilting. Stems may become less rigid and more susceptible to damage. Sugar concentrations may also decline as the plant utilizes energy reserves for metabolic processes. Cutting peonies during midday subjects them to increased stress, potentially reducing their vase life and aesthetic appeal. Dehydration also plays a key factor in this process.
-
Evening Harvest Considerations
While not as advantageous as morning harvesting, evening harvesting can be a viable alternative under certain circumstances. After the peak heat of the day has subsided, plants may partially recover their water turgor. However, sugar concentrations may remain lower compared to morning levels. Evening harvesting may be preferable to midday harvesting, but care should be taken to ensure adequate hydration of the stems after cutting. Pre-cooling may also assist with bringing out the blooms fully.
-
Post-Harvest Handling Protocols
Regardless of the time of day, proper post-harvest handling protocols are essential for maximizing the vase life of cut peony blooms. Immediate placement of stems in cool, clean water is crucial for preventing dehydration. Removing lower foliage that would be submerged in water reduces bacterial contamination. Proper sanitation of cutting tools minimizes the risk of disease transmission. These practices complement the benefits of harvesting at the optimal time of day, ensuring the longevity and aesthetic appeal of the cut flowers.

Frequently Asked Questions About Cutting Peony Blooms
The following addresses common inquiries related to harvesting peonies for optimal vase life and bloom quality.
Question 1: What is the “marshmallow test” and how does it relate to cutting peonies?
The “marshmallow test” refers to a tactile assessment of the peony bud. The bud should feel similar to a marshmallow slightly soft but not mushy indicating the petals are developed enough to open fully after cutting.
Question 2: Can peonies be cut too early?
Yes. Harvesting prematurely, before the bud shows color or has the proper tactile feel, often results in blooms that fail to open fully. The bud lacks the energy reserves needed for complete development.
Question 3: Is it possible to cut peonies too late?
Indeed. If the bud is already partially open or the petals are starting to separate, the vase life will be significantly shortened. The bloom is nearing the end of its natural life cycle.
Question 4: Does the presence of ants guarantee that peonies are ready to be cut?
Not necessarily. Ants are attracted to the sugary nectar on peony buds, but their presence alone is not a reliable indicator of readiness. Other factors, such as bud size, color, and feel, should also be considered.
Question 5: How does weather impact the ideal time to cut peony blooms?
Hot weather accelerates bloom development, shortening the harvest window. Rain increases the risk of fungal diseases. Ideally, peonies should be cut on a cool, dry morning.
Question 6: Can cut peony blooms be stored for later use?
Yes. Peony buds can be stored in a cool, dark place for several weeks. Wrap the stems in damp paper towels and place them in a plastic bag. When ready to use, recut the stems and place them in water.

Tips
Optimizing the harvest of peony flowers demands attention to several critical factors, influencing both longevity and aesthetic presentation. These guidelines, when carefully observed, support maximizing the cut blooms’ potential.
Tip 1: Conduct Tactile Evaluation: Evaluate the “marshmallow feel” of the bud. A slight give indicates readiness, while excessive firmness or softness signals immaturity or over-ripeness, respectively.
Tip 2: Monitor Color Visibility: Observe the bud for color emergence. Color indicates the petals are developing internally. If there is no color, it needs more time.
Tip 3: Assess Stem Strength: Examine the stem’s rigidity. It should be firm and strong enough to support the bud without bending excessively.
Tip 4: Consider Weather Conditions: Plan cutting activities during cool, dry periods, avoiding wet or excessively hot days.
Tip 5: Adhere to Morning Harvesting: Prioritize harvesting early in the morning, when the plant is fully hydrated, and sugar concentrations are high.
Tip 6: Implement Proper Storage Techniques: When storage is necessary, wrap the cut stems in damp paper towels, seal them in a plastic bag, and refrigerate.
Tip 7: Ensure Clean Cutting Tools: Use sharp, sanitized cutting tools to minimize the risk of disease transmission and ensure clean stem cuts.
